UN Security Council—Minus China and Russia—Condemns Myanmar Military
Myanmar, also known as Burma, has been embroiled in turmoil since February 1, 2021, when the military, led by General Min Aung Hlaing, staged a coup and ousted the democratically elected government led by Aung San Suu Kyi.
